#bb3488 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#bb3488 is composed of 73.3% red, 20.4% green and 53.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 72.2% magenta, 27.3% yellow and 26.7% black. It has a hue angle of 322.7 degrees, a saturation of 56.5% and a lightness of 46.9%. #bb3488 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ff68ff with #770011. Closest websafe color is: #cc3399.

Shades and Tints of #bb3488

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030102 is the darkest color, while #fcf2f8 is the lightest one.

Tones of #bb3488

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#7b7478 is the less saturated color, while #e90693 is the most saturated one.
